Dairy Dash to follow after Diner Dash

dairy-dash.jpgPlayFirst has announced a brand new game launch today - Dairy Dash. This challenging time management game will draw plenty of experience from PlayFirst’s enormously popular Diner Dash series, changing the environment into a different setting this time round - you have been placed as a worker on an organic farm. Players are supposed to test their time management skills to the limit by putting themselves into the shoes of a hard-working, energetic dairy farmer. Developed by Merscom, Dairy Dash can now be downloaded from http://www.PlayFirst.com (both Mac and PC versions).

The story goes like this - it “focuses on a typical suburban family, the Smiths, and the transformative experience they share when they leave their tech-dominated life behind to take over an uncle’s dairy farm. The family grows closer as they learn to care for everything from cows and goats to pumpkins and corn. They are encouraged along the way by Diner Dash heroine and PlayFirst mascot Flo, who helps keep the Smith farm in business by ordering fresh produce for her restaurants back in Dinertown.”

According to Kenny Shea Dinkin, vice president and creative director of PlayFirst, Inc., “Dairy Dash is a fantastically fun, fast-paced, food-filled frolic through four fabulous farms. And wait until you meet the Smiths! One of the game’s best features is that you get to play more than one character at a time. Dairy Dash moves at such a feverish pace, it takes the whole family just to keep up with the action!” The full version will retail for $19.95 a pop.
